That lease offer you posted requires $6,500 down. If you divide that out over the 24 months lease term, the lease "special" at Turnersville is actually $570 a month.
When you spread the down payment of your friend's lease into the lease term of 36 months it is $550 per month. Looks like your friend's deal is better.

Not that I'd do either of these leases. Over $400 a month for a 1500 Big Horn lease, any 1500 Big Horn lease, is insane.
